Tashin Holdings Bhd (0211) has a Defensive Interval Ratio of 374 days as of December 2025. Defensive assets of RM70.08 Million (cash RM-, short-term investments RM-, receivables RM70.08 Million) cover 374 days of daily cash needs of RM187.49K/day. Annual Defensive Interval Ratio for Tashin Holdings Bhd (2015–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Defensive Interval Ratio for Tashin Holdings Bhd from 2015 to 2025, covering 11 annual filings. Each row shows defensive assets, daily cash need, the DIR in days, and the change in days compared to the prior year. Year DIR (days) Defensive Assets (MYR) Daily Cash Need Cash ST Investments Change (days)
2025 374 days RM70.08 Million RM187.49K/day RM- RM- ▲ +85 days
2024 288 days RM75.45 Million RM261.68K/day RM- RM- ▼ -238 days
2023 526 days RM75.53 Million RM143.58K/day RM- RM- ▲ +185 days
2022 341 days RM84.00 Million RM246.21K/day RM- RM- ▲ +127 days
2021 215 days RM77.80 Million RM362.51K/day RM- RM- ▼ -339 days
2020 554 days RM64.15 Million RM115.81K/day RM- RM- ▲ +172 days
2019 382 days RM57.20 Million RM149.59K/day RM- RM- ▼ -111 days
2018 494 days RM49.98 Million RM101.26K/day RM- RM- ▲ +296 days
2017 197 days RM57.30 Million RM290.21K/day RM- RM- ▼ -148 days
2016 346 days RM62.67 Million RM181.31K/day RM- RM- ▲ +69 days
2015 277 days RM57.55 Million RM207.82K/day RM- RM-
DIR = (Cash + Short-term Investments + Net Receivables) / (Daily Cash Expenses)
